If the measure of arc GH= 90° and the measure of arc EF= 45°, calculate m∠GDH.
user100 [1]

Answer:

∠ GDH = 67.5°

Step-by-step explanation:

The measure of the chord- chord angle GDH is half the sum of the measures of the arcs intercepted by the angle and its vertical angle.

∠ GDH = \frac{1}{2}(GH + EF) = \frac{1}{2} (90 + 45)° = 0.5 × 135° = 67.5°

A cone with a radius of 6 cm has a volume of 1200 cm3. What is the height of the cone? (The volume of a cone is given by the for
Rina8888 [55]

Answer:

  • 31.8 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Volume of a cone:</u>

  • V = 1/3πr²h

<u>We have:</u>

  • V = 1200 cm³
  • r = 6 cm
  • h = ?

<u>Substitute values and solve for h:</u>

  • 1200 = 1/3*3.14*6²h
  • 1200 = 37.68h
  • h = 1200/37.68
  • h = 31.8 cm (rounded)
